Schizachyrium sanguineum
Schizachyrium sanguineum (Retz.) Alston
Crimson Bluestem, Crimson False Bluestem
Poaceae (Grass family)
Synonym(s):
USDA Symbol: SCSA
USDA Native Status: L48 (N), PR (N), VI (N)
From the Image Gallery
No images of this plant
Plant Characteristics
Duration: PerennialHabit: Grass/Grass-like
Fruit Type: Caryopsis
Size Notes: Up to about 4 feet tall.
Bloom Information
Bloom Color: White , Green , Purple , BrownBloom Time: Jun , Jul , Aug , Sep , Oct
Distribution
USA: AL , AZ , FL , GA , NM , TXNative Habitat: Rocky slopes and well drained soils.
